Output 908aab4a8e6cdb0cfe1b8dd6a3e13e2a37357b73db84de013bc46be07017d79b:1

value
56599000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f98cf52fc5c8e27943d4160b38de8d14b65b5f04 OP_EQUAL
address
3QSX3E5tC1Q6nWE7ioBMg76AxD3ekyPGVx
transaction
908aab4a8e6cdb0cfe1b8dd6a3e13e2a37357b73db84de013bc46be07017d79b
confirmations
334932
spent
true